Unveiling BRONZE FACES #2: Cultural Shadows and Strategic Showdowns
Get ready for an electrifying narrative as BOOM! Studios teases their latest thrill, BRONZE FACES #2. This gripping tale, woven by the acclaimed Shobo and Shof of New Masters fame, draws heavily from Nigerian cultural roots. With the talented Eisner-winning Alexandre Tefenkgi illustrating, alongside veteran colorist Lee Loughridge and skilled letterer Hassan Otsmane-Elhaou, this series promises an extraordinary blend of action and depth. Set to release in March 2025, BRONZE FACES seamlessly fuses adventure with poignant historical and mythological insights, all while exploring the dark echoes of colonial impact.
Clashing Visions on the Kano Express
The central plot thickens as the enigmatic Bronze Faces embark on a perilous heist aboard the luxurious Kano Express. However, tensions mount swiftly within the group, as divergent strategies threaten to unravel their mission. Detective Emily Lai inches closer to uncovering the truth behind the Soho heist. Just as crucial links in the investigation start coming together, one impulsive action exposes a deeply buried secret.
The anticipation builds with BRONZE FACES #2, which showcases enticing cover art. The primary cover crafted by series co-creator Shof is complemented by a variant from the esteemed illustrator Juni Ba, known for works like The Boy Wonder.
